What should I do if I am unhappy with my lawyer’s services?
If you are unhappy with your lawyer’s services in Virginia, there are several steps you can take. First, discuss your concerns with the lawyer or the law firm. You should be able to explain the problem, and the lawyer may be able to resolve it for you. If your problem is not fixed, or if you are uncomfortable speaking directly to your lawyer, you can file a complaint with the Virginia State Bar. The Virginia State Bar has a grievance system to handle complaints about attorneys. You can file a complaint online, by mail, or in person. The specifics of the complaint process can be found on the Virginia State Bar website. In your complaint, be sure to provide as much detail as possible, including the name of your lawyer, the nature of your complaint, and any relevant documents. You may also be able to pursue other legal remedies, such as filing a lawsuit against your lawyer. However, it is important to note that you will need to prove your case in court, and this may be costly. If you are still unhappy with your lawyer after taking these steps, it may be best to find a new lawyer. Before selecting a new lawyer, be sure to research their experience and qualifications, so that you select someone you are comfortable with.
